ALVAREZ CISNEROS, Germán Antonio et al. Trabeculotomy-trabeculectomy as initial surgical treatment for primary congenital glaucoma. Rev Cubana Oftalmol [online]. 2020, vol.33, n.4 Epub 08-Fev-2021. ISSN 1561-3070.
Primary congenital glaucoma is the most common form of childhood glaucoma. This condition requires early diagnosis and relatively urgent surgical treatment, since it may leave serious morphological and functional sequelae. A description is provided of the first combined trabeculotomy-trabeculectomy performed in the People's Democratic Republic of Algeria. The operation was performed on a male one-year-old Arab patient diagnosed with primary congenital glaucoma II. Post-operative follow-up found satisfactory results, and trabeculotomy-trabeculectomy was thus considered to be an effective, sufficiently safe surgical procedure, which should be performed by qualified personnel to be accepted as the first surgical treatment option for primary congenital glaucoma.
